Can a Class 9 student give NTSE?

Can a Class 9 student give NTSE?

The candidates who are in class IX can also appear for the NTSE. The candidate must clear the class IX exam with 60 \% marks. The NTSE reservation policy is the same for all the candidates. The percentage reservation offered remains the same for the candidates studying in India or abroad.

Is NTSE exam difficult?

The National Talent Search Examination (NTSE) is one of the hardest school level scholarship exams that India’s education system has up its sleeve. The exam recognizes the talent of deserving students, from a pool of millions, takes some doing, and this is what makes the NTSE so challenging.

Is NTSE very important?

An NTSE scholar can pass the admission test of a college and get direct entry to it. An NTSE scholar is given more preference in government jobs and is also helpful when appearing for interviews in different prestigious jobs. It is also widely accepted for private jobs.
